Suncatcher Butterfly Craft

Decorate your windows for Spring and Summer by trying this suncatcher
butterfly craft with your kids. It's fun squishing the two sides of the
butterfly together! Instructions below.
You will need:
Coloured cellaphane
Glitter glue
Instructions:
Cut two identical butterfly shapes from the cellophane.
Decorate one with glitter glue (make sure you don’t go too close to the edge.
Sandwich your second butterfly on top pressing together so the glue will spread.
Leave to dry and then punch a hole in the top and hang in your window... and
hope for some sunshine to make your suncatcher butterfly come to life!
